Collins appointed to several key committees

Ike Hayman

Republican Congressman Mike Collins, elected in November to represent Athens and surrounding counties in Georgia's 10th Congressional district, has been appointed to several key House committees.

He was selected for the Committee on Science, Space, and Technology which has jurisdiction over energy, aeronautical, and other non-defense research as well as federally owned and operated non-military laboratories. The committee also oversees federal government agencies like the National Weather Service.

Collins is the first Georgia Republican since 2021 to serve on the Committee on Transportation and Infrastructure which deals with highways, railroads, bridges, aviation, maritime, and waterborne transit.

He was also appointed to the Natural Resources Committee that holds wide ranging jurisdiction over United States energy production, mining, fisheries and wildlife, public lands, oceans, legislation involving Native Americans and other environmental matters.
